> As part of my duties at work, I support our fleet of Thinkpads. All are
> purchased with 9x5 On-site Next Business Day ServicePacks, and the extended
> support is always shown when I check the warranty status online. However, I
> have noticed that the last few times I've placed a service call, the agent
> has initially told me that the unit is out of warranty. Each time, I have
> had to point out that it has a ServicePack, and upon "double-checking" they
> find out I am correct.
>
> This only started happening a few months ago, and I would like to think
> that it's not some sort of ploy introduced under the Lenovo regime in an
> attempt to bluff unknowing TP owners into spending money on repairs that
> should be covered under their extended warranties.
>
> Has anyone else noticed this behaviour?
